Description

Indulge in a unique and flavorful dish with this Grilled Watermelon Steak topped with Warm Ricotta and Balsamic Pearls. The combination of sweet watermelon, creamy ricotta, and tangy balsamic pearls creates a delightful symphony of flavors and textures.


Ingredients

Units Scale

For the watermelon steak:

  • 1 large seedless watermelon (cut into 23 thick “steaks”)
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tbsp balsamic vinegar
  • 1 tsp smoked paprika
  • 1 tsp sea sal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per

For the warm ricotta:

  • 1 1/2 cups ricotta cheese
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p honey
  • Pinch of salt
  • Zest of 1 lemon

For the balsamic pearls:

  • 1/3 cup balsamic vinegar
  • 1 tsp agar agar powder (or use store-bought balsamic pearls if available)

For garnish:

  • Fresh basil leaves
  • Crushed pistachios (optional)
  • Extra drizzle of honey

Instructions

  1. Prepare the balsamic pearls: In a small saucepan, heat balsamic vinegar until warm but not boiling. Whisk in agar agar and simmer for 2–3 minutes until fully dissolved. Drop tiny droplets into cold oil (kept in a cup in the freezer) to form pearls. Strain and set aside.
  2. Prepare the watermelon: Cut watermelon into thick steak-like slabs (about 1.5–2 inches thick). Pat dry to remove excess moisture.
  3. Marinate: Mix olive oil, balsamic vinegar,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per. Brush generously over watermelon steaks. Let sit for 10–15 minutes.
  4. Grill: Heat a grill or grill pan over medium-high heat. Grill watermelon steaks for 3–4 minutes per side until char marks form and edges slightly caramelize.
  5. Prepare warm ricotta: In a small pan over low heat, warm ricotta with olive oil, honey, salt, and lemon zest. Stir gently until creamy and slightly loosened (do not overheat).
  6. Assemble: Spread warm ricotta on a plate, place grilled watermelon steak on top, and scatter balsamic pearls over it.
  7. Garnish: Add fresh basil, crushed pistachios, and a light drizzle of honey.
